Safe Storage Solutions for Your Gems
When it comes to storing your precious gemstones, having the right solutions is key to keeping them safe and sound. Whether you own a dazzling diamond or a vibrant emerald, protecting your gems from damage is essential. Here are some easy and effective storage options that won't break the bank.
First off, consider using a dedicated jewelry box. Look for one with soft lining to prevent scratches, and compartments to keep each piece separated. This way, you won’t have to worry about your stones knocking into each other. Bonus points if it has a lock for added security!
If you're short on space or prefer a minimalist approach, small pouches or soft fabric bags can do the trick. Make sure they're made from non-abrasive materials. Just toss your gems in, and store them in a drawer or your closet. It's a simple and effective way to keep them protected.
For those who want to take extra precautions, consider using a fireproof safe for high-value pieces. This can be a great investment as it not only protects against theft but also safeguards your gems from potential disasters at home. Look for one with a moisture control feature to keep humidity levels down, which is vital for certain gemstones.
Common Mistakes to Avoid with Gemstones
When it comes to taking care of your gemstones, a few common mistakes can really put a damper on their beauty and value. Let's walk through some of these pitfalls so you can keep your gems shining brightly!
First off, many people underestimate how important it is to store gemstones properly. Tossing them into a drawer or mixing them with other jewelry can cause scratches and damage. Instead, consider using individual pouches or a soft jewelry box. This keeps them safe and helps maintain their sparkling surface.
Another big mistake? Neglecting regular cleaning. You might think that just wearing them takes care of things, but dirt, oils, and residue can build up over time. A gentle soap solution and a soft brush can work wonders. Just remember to check if your gemstone has any special care instructions, especially if it's more delicate!
Avoid exposing your gemstones to harsh chemicals or extreme temperature changes. Household cleaners can degrade stones, while rapid changes in temperature can lead to cracks. Stick to a gentle cleaning routine and be mindful when using products around your gems.
Lastly, don’t skip the professional check-ups. Just like a car needs regular servicing, your gemstones benefit from being looked at by a jeweler. They can inspect for any loose settings or needed repairs, helping to prolong the life of your beautiful pieces.
